成都高新区“进解优促”激发民营经济活力
Zhong Guo Chan Ye Jing Ji Xin Xi Wang· 2025-09-11 22:30
Group 1 - The core viewpoint highlights the robust growth of the private economy in Chengdu High-tech Zone, with 25,200 new private enterprises established and a private economy value added of 1,040.1 billion yuan in the first half of 2025 [1] - Chengdu High-tech Zone has implemented a comprehensive service mechanism for enterprises, focusing on addressing common issues related to policies, markets, finance, and talent through a specialized problem-solving team [1] - The zone has conducted visits to 3,584 enterprises, resolving over 1,000 enterprise requests with a completion rate of 97.97%, demonstrating a strong commitment to responsive service [1] Group 2 - Chengdu High-tech Zone has launched a supply-demand matching platform and released 20 technology innovation application scenarios, enhancing enterprise development through diverse application scenarios [2] - Eight application scenarios, including AI smart diagnosis and unmanned buses, have been successfully implemented, with over 80 scenario lists published to support innovation [2] - The financial service system for private enterprises has been improved, with 60 enterprises visited, resulting in a total of 600 million yuan in new pre-credits and 239 million yuan in loans issued [2] Group 3 - The zone has introduced an "automatic enjoyment" service model, allowing enterprises to receive benefits without the need for active application, streamlining the process significantly [3] - Companies can now receive subsidies directly through data comparison, exemplified by a software company receiving a 30,000 yuan employment subsidy without submitting application materials [3] Group 4 - In the first half of the year, Chengdu High-tech Zone disbursed a total of 519 million yuan in industrial support funds, benefiting over 12,500 enterprises [4] - The zone has nurtured 3,612 innovative small and medium-sized enterprises, 1,128 specialized and innovative enterprises, and 142 national-level "little giant" enterprises, leading in various metrics within Sichuan Province and Chengdu [4] - Future plans include deepening enterprise service mechanisms, expanding application scenarios, enhancing financial support, and optimizing talent services to further stimulate the innovation vitality of the private economy [4]
